Key Insights

The global export warranty market, valued at USD 34,460 million in 2023, is projected to reach USD 72,418 million by 2033, exhibiting a CAGR of 8.7% during the forecast period (2023-2033). The market growth is attributed to the increasing demand for export financing and the need for businesses to protect themselves against the risks associated with international trade.

The market is segmented based on type (pre-shipment warranty, post-shipment warranty) and application (SMEs, large enterprises). Pre-shipment warranties are expected to hold a larger market share during the forecast period due to their ability to protect exporters from the risks associated with production and delivery of goods. Post-shipment warranties, on the other hand, are expected to witness a higher growth rate due to the increasing demand for post-sales support and protection against the risks of non-payment and late payment. In terms of application, large enterprises are expected to dominate the market due to their higher export volumes and the need for comprehensive risk protection. However, SMEs are expected to witness a higher growth rate due to the increasing number of small and medium-sized businesses entering the global marketplace.

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Export Warranty

  • Global Economic Recovery: Post-pandemic economic recovery has revived trade activities, fueling the demand for export warranties.
  • Government Support: Governments are incentivizing exporters by providing subsidies and favorable insurance schemes to promote exports.
  • Increased Financial Risks: Complex global supply chains and geopolitical uncertainties have increased the financial risks associated with cross-border trade, leading to a higher demand for export warranties.
  • Technological Advancements: Digitization has streamlined export warranty processes, reducing costs and improving efficiency.
Export Warranty Growth

Challenges and Restraints in Export Warranty

  • Regulatory Complexities: Different countries have varying regulations and documentation requirements for export warranties, creating compliance challenges.
  • Cost Considerations: Export warranties can be expensive, especially for small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s).
  • Limited Availability: Access to export warranties may be limited in certain countries or for specific sectors.
  • Lack of Awareness: Some businesses may not be fully aware of the benefits and availability of export warranties.
